| anisocoria |
Unequal pupil size. Causes include glaucoma, head or eye trauma, an intracranial tumor, infection of the membranes surrounding the brain and previous intraocular surgery. A small percent of the population has unequal-sized pupils naturally (without any known cause).

| anisometropia |
Condition where the eyes have a significantly different refractive power from each other, so the prescription required for good vision will be different for each eye.

| anisogamy |
Fusion of motile gametes that are unequal in size; occurs in some Chytridiomycetes, not in any plant pathogenic fungi.
